#6482a0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6482a0 is composed of 39.2% red, 51%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.5% cyan, 18.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 24% and a lightness of 51%. #6482a0 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ffff with #000541.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#6482a0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6482a0 has RGB values of R:100, G:130,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 6587040.

Shades and Tints of #6482a0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f6f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6482a0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818283 is the less saturated color, while #0d82f7 is the most saturated one.
